MANASQUAN PARK POST OFFICE AND GENERAL STORE
This General Store is located at the southeast corner
of Ramshorne Drive and
Holly Boulevard and toady is a private home.
This General Store was operated by Wilhelmina Brewer
and in 1924 a Post
Office was established there, It was run by Mrs. Brewer
until her death in
1932. Her son Robert then took over until 1933 when
the Post Office
Department closed it for economy reasons.
The first Mail Messenger was Alfred W. Chapman. The
mail was picked up at the
Allenwood Post Office where it was sorted and ready
to be taken to the
Manasquan Park Post Office. Mr Chapman was paid $2.50
per week and carried
the mail on bicycle
approximately four mile round trip daily.
